river red gum

Noun

river red gum (plural river red gums)

  1. (Australia) A red gum tree of species Eucalyptus camaldulensis (syn. E. rostrata Schltdl., nom. illeg.).
    • 1987, Bruce Chatwin, The Songlines, Vintage, published 1998, page 128:
      Around lunchtime we crossed a creek with river-red-gums growing in its bed.
